Construction of Biggest Gas Steam Rig Ends in Azerbaijan

Company Azerenergy informed Trend that the construction work in the territory of Sumgayit Hydro-power Grid, where a 506MW gas-steam device is being installed, is nearing completion. The assembly of the equipment will commence in due course.

At present a water intake station has been built on the Caspian coast to receive water for cooling. In addition, a 3 km length pipe of immense diameter has been laid. New pipes of glass fiber plastic were used (for the first time in Azerbaijan) during the construction of this pipeline. The greater part of the work of dismantling the old equipment at the Thermo-power station has also been completed.

The project on the construction of the gas-steam rig is estimated at EUR 257 mln. A finance agreement on the project was signed with Bayern LB bank, Germany, Societe de General, France, and BNP Paribas, France. All three banks will take on identical loans with an interest rate of Libor +0.55%.

Azerenerji signed an agreement with German company Siemens on the construction of a gas-steam device in Sumgayit. The contract covers the construction of a 506MW gas-steam device in the territory of Sumgayit City.
